our team as we help shape a brighter way forward. As the Property
Manager, you will provide leadership to your team and outstanding
customer service to your clients, while managing our portfolio. You
are responsible for all aspects of client and tenant satisfaction.
As the lead professional, you will also be responsible for
preparing budgets and financial reports, managing Tenant
Improvements and/or capital improvement projects, and developing
your staff. The Property Manager role is based on-site in downtown
Denver overseeing a portfolio of 3 buildings (approx 300k sq ft)
WHAT YOU’LL BE DOING Communication and Leadership: Effectively and
regularly communicate with the General Manager and/or Regional
Leadership on significant operating issues at the building,
including client or tenant concerns. Budgeting and Financial
Management: Assist in the preparation of the annual budget and
associated documentation, such as explanatory notes. Review
financial statements and reports for the property, including
occupancy rates and lease expiration dates. Analyze financial
statements to project future financial positions and budget
requirements. Prepare and review financial reports for clients on a
monthly, quarterly, and annual basis, complying with the
requirements in the management services agreement. Property
Inspections and Enhancements: Inspect properties and equipment to
assess the extent of service and equipment required. Recommend,
justify, develop, and coordinate projects aimed at enhancing the
value of the buildings. Work with the Engineering and maintenance
team to facilitate maintenance, repairs, or renovations. Obtain
bids from outside contractors following client and JLL guidelines.
Manage construction projects, such as tenant improvements, restroom
renovations, and major repair and maintenance projects. Review
construction specifications or plans, seeking advice from relevant
stakeholders. Lease Administration and Tenant Relations: Support
the Brokerage Team in the review of lease proposals and lease
language. Manage the lease administration process, from reviewing
lease proposals to coordinating tenant construction and preparing
lease abstracts. Maintain an intimate knowledge of lease
agreements, ensuring compliance from an accounting and operations
standpoint. Act as the primary or secondary contact for tenants
regarding tenant service requests. Proactively meet with tenant
representatives on a scheduled basis. Financial Management and
Contracting: Work with Client Accounting Services to manage the
accounting process and direct on-site bookkeeping functions and the
collection process. Review account aging reports to assess
collection status and outstanding balances. Evaluate current
collection policies and procedures. Submit tenant accounts to
attorneys or agencies for collection with client approval. Assist
with tenant evictions in compliance with court orders and
instructions from specified attorneys and clients. Prepare
adjustments to the tenant billing process, demonstrating a strong
understanding of CPI increases, CAM reconciliations, escalations,
recoveries, special charges, etc. Competitively bid and prepare all
service contracts to ensure high-quality and cost-effective
services. Analyze contract bids, submit bids and recommendations,
and execute standard form contract agreements. Act as the primary
contact for service contractors and vendors. Team Communication:
Regularly communicate with the property team, providing necessary
support and information to this primary tenant contact. ADDITIONAL
DUTIES and RESPONSIBILITIES: Inspect all properties on a regular
basis to ensure that building operations are conducted according to
JLL standards and procedures. Establish, communicate, and manage
the tenant move-in/move-out process to minimize disruption to
established tenants. Ensure that appropriate insurance requirements
are in place for all properties. WHAT YOU BRING TO THE TABLE
Education/Experience: Associate or bachelor's degree is required. A
degree in Finance or Accounting is preferred. An advanced degree is
a plus. Minimum of three (3) years of commercial real estate or
property management experience, including budget
preparation/financial reporting, knowledge of building systems,
lease documentation, and administration. Must obtain the required
real estate license within your jurisdiction, such as a salesperson
license or property management license. Certifications/Licenses:
Real estate license required within six (6) months of hire date.
LEED AP or GA accreditation is preferred. Skills and Abilities:
Communication Skills: Ability to read, analyze, and interpret legal
documents (lease documents, claims of lien, etc.), business
periodicals, professional journals, technical procedures, and
government regulations. Proficiency in producing well-written
reports, business correspondence, and procedure manuals. Effective
presentation skills to communicate information to senior level
management, clients, tenants, vendors, peers, and the public.
Mathematical Skills: Ability to calculate figures and amounts, such
as discounts, interest, commissions, prorations, percentages, and
basic rent, parking fees, and late fees. Proficiency in applying
concepts such as fractions, percentages, ratios, and proportions to
practical situations. Ability to analyze, interpret, and explain
financial statements and calculate dollar and percentage variances.
Strong financial and accounting acumen, including a clear
understanding of cash and accrual accounting procedures. Reasoning
Ability: Strong problem-solving skills, including the ability to
define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id
conclusions. Ability to solve practical problems and handle a
variety of concrete variables in situations with limited
standardization. Ability to interpret various instructions
presented in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form. Strategic
thinking skills with a focus on implementation and execution.
